Alberta Securities Commission Issues Warning
The **Alberta Securities Commission** (ASC) has issued a fraud alert regarding **Polar Tensor**, indicating that the company is not registered to trade in securities or derivatives within Alberta.
Understanding the Warning
This warning is significant for both potential investors and the MLM community at large. The ASC's notice indicates that **Polar Tensor** may be targeting individuals affected by the recently collapsed **BG Wealth Sharing** and **DSJ Exchange** schemes, potentially adding to their hardships.
Consequences of Unregistered Trading
The ASC emphasizes that engaging with a firm like **Polar Tensor**, which is unregistered, poses severe risks. Without registration, investors lack critical protections, increasing their vulnerability to potential fraud. Offering unregistered securities breaches provincial financial laws, categorizing it as securities fraud.
“Investors are urged to avoid firms that are not properly registered as there is no assurance of any protections.”
Polar Tensor's Operations and Alleged Ties
According to the ASC, **Polar Tensor** operates through the websites “polar-tensor.com” and “polar-money.com.” It markets itself as an AI trading bot within a multi-level marketing (MLM) framework, but industry observers have flagged it as a Ponzi scheme. The operation is purportedly controlled by a figure named “Felix Bick,” who alternates between a live actor and an AI-generated avatar.
Notably, **Bob Bearden**, a U.S. national, is reportedly involved in promoting **Polar Tensor**, raising concerns about the legitimacy and structure of the operation.
Website Traffic and Geographic Reach
As of April 2026, analytics from SimilarWeb show that **Polar Tensor** has garnered approximately 102,000 visits monthly. Interestingly, almost all of this traffic originates from Germany (98%), with a mere 1% from the United States.
